1. Noom – Psychology-Based Weight Loss 🧠📱
Why it works:
Noom isn’t just about food—it’s about mindset. This app-based program blends calorie tracking, habit coaching, and psychological insight to help users build healthier habits that stick.
Who it's for:
People who love data, accountability, and daily bite-sized lessons on nutrition and behavior change.
Bonus: You get a personal coach and peer support, which makes the journey less lonely.
✅ Best for those who struggle with emotional eating or yo-yo dieting.
2. WeightWatchers (WW) – Proven, Flexible, and Modern 💙✨
Why it works:
WW has stood the test of time—because it works. The new WW program uses personalized SmartPoints, food tracking, and coaching. But what’s really appealing in 2025 is the WW app’s meal suggestions, barcode scanner, and fitness sync capabilities.
What’s new:
They now offer a glucose-tracking weight loss plan that adjusts food suggestions in real-time based on your blood sugar trends.
✅ Perfect for people who want variety, community, and flexibility without cutting out entire food groups.
3. Mayo Clinic Diet – Doctor-Designed & Heart-Healthy ❤️🥦
Why it works:
The Mayo Clinic Diet promotes real food, lifestyle shifts, and gradual weight loss. There’s a focus on portion control, low-energy-dense foods, and habit tracking.
Phases include:
-
“Lose It!” (initial 2-week kickstart)
-
“Live It!” (long-term sustainable habits)
Bonus: It’s created by health professionals—so it’s safe, holistic, and encourages balanced meals.
✅ Ideal for people who want a medically-approved program that’s low on gimmicks and high on results.
4. Optavia – Meal Replacements + Coaching 🥤📦
Why it works:
Optavia combines portion-controlled fuelings (pre-packaged meals/snacks) with lean-and-green homemade meals and one-on-one coaching.
What makes it effective:
-
Simple and structured
-
Designed for quick results
-
Daily support from a coach
Heads-up: This one requires buying their products, which can be pricey.
✅ Best for people who want maximum structure and minimal meal planning.

FAQs About the Best Weight Loss Programs in 2025 🤔
Q: What’s the most effective weight loss program today?
A: Programs like Noom, WeightWatchers, and Mayo Clinic Diet lead the pack due to their science-based, habit-building structures.
Q: Can I lose weight without exercise?
A: Yes, though combining diet with activity accelerates results. Diet plays the biggest role in weight loss, while exercise supports fat loss and overall health.
Q: Are apps enough, or do I need coaching too?
A: Apps like Noom or WW are great solo tools, but if you struggle with motivation, having a coach (like with Optavia or Golo) can increase accountability.
Q: Are weight loss supplements necessary?
A: Most aren’t. Programs like Golo include a supplement, but sustainable weight loss typically doesn’t rely on pills—just consistency and healthy habits.
Q: What’s the safest way to lose weight fast?
A: Aiming for 1–2 pounds per week with a calorie deficit, balanced meals, and proper hydration is both effective and safe.
